Clinical Significance

Scores 0–1 make HFpEF unlikely, 5–6 support HFpEF, and 2–4 require functional testing.

When to Use

  • Use as decision support when all required inputs are reliable.

How It Is Calculated

  • Each domain contributes 0, 1 or 2 points; total 0–6.

Interpretation

  • Scores 0–1 make HFpEF unlikely, 5–6 support HFpEF, and 2–4 require functional testing.
